Hi;
I am a studen teacher and I am going to teach quantifiers(some,any,much,many). But I don �t know how to start the lesson. If you give me some advice for warm-up, I will be very glad.

Quantifiers go very well with food topic. You can start the class with some new vocab if they don �t know food words, or if they know you can talk about what the students have in their fridge. Write things they say on the board, then try to divide them into count and uncount. Here is where you start the grammar itself.

I agree with Yulia. Food is best to use for teaching this. Print some food cards.
Basically, I think you need to not get technical or use the word "countable" or "uncountable" with your students unless they are Senior High School age or OLDER. Maybe just teach the words "a" = one (1) and "some" = a portion of varying amounts. Example: Could I have "a" candy? means just one. Could I have "some" candy? might mean 2 or 3 or 7. When you ask about rice, you say Could I have "some" rice? because you can �t count the rice or if you ask
Could I have "a" rice? you will get 1 grain of rice, which is just weird. Liquids, such as milk and juice etc are all "some" unless a) it is in a small container - such as a soda pop can
b) it can be completely drank by the person asking.
These are the general rules. I have a least one good game for this but the file is too big to upload. I will try to think of how to shrink it. Good luck and keep it simple with these rules.
